Kinetic solitary electrostatic structures in collisionless plasma: Phase-space holes
The physics of isolated plasma potential structures sustained by a deficit of phase-space density on trapped orbits, commonly known as electron or ion holes, is reviewed. The principles of their equilibria are explained and illustrated, and contrasted with solitons. A review of literature mostly from prior to 2016 highlights the …
